We're looking for a high-energy, Mechanical HVAC Engineer to focus on our Data Center . Join us, and you’ll impact our success by delivering innovative HVAC design solutions for our Data Center clients. You will work alongside our team of engineers and designers performing field investigations, interfacing with clients & vendors, sizing and selecting equipment, and preparing construction design packages.
You’ll be accountable for the schedule and technical quality of challenging engineering tasks as you gain familiarity with the client’s expectations, scope, budget, and schedule. You’ll work with a multi-discipline, highly interactive team to establish a process design basis, develop an optimized process, create calculations, and generate process drawings. Your role keeps our company connected, and we’ll support you with what you need to be successful.
Highlights of your contributions will include:
- Layout and design of HVAC systems for various types of clients, including electric vehicles, data centers, and heavy industrial facilities.
- Development of the design criteria for the HVAC systems. These HVAC systems would include general comfort heating and cooling, those with accurate temperature or humidity control, unique pressurization requirements, and/or cleanliness requirements for clean room applications.
- Development of conceptual design and preliminary design documents, which would include calculations related to sizing and selecting these systems, the development of Process and Instrumentation Diagrams (P&IDs), and general arrangements.
- Layout of Ductwork systems based on a Process and Instrumentation Diagram (P&ID).
- Development of final design documents including specification, sequences of operation, piping layout, and final construction documents associated with these systems. These systems would include chilled water, cooling water, etc.
- Coordination with other disciplines.

Here's what you'll need
- Ten (10) or more years’ experience in the design of HVAC systems.
- Professional Engineering License.
- Thorough knowledge of codes and standards related to the design of HVAC systems.
- Bachelor of Science Degree in Mechanical Engineering.
- Adaptability to work within a fast-paced team environment with multiple deadlines.
- Ability to follow lead a building mechanical team on a project and to collaborate with other discipline team members remotely.
Ideally, You’ll Also Have:
- Software experience in Revit, AutoCAD, Carrier HAP, Trane Trace 700, and Trane Trace 3D.
- Experience in the design of plumbing/utility systems.
